使用GitHub违法吗?法律视角下的GitHub使用解析

在当今的技术环境中,GitHub作为一个全球最大的代码托管平台,受到了广泛的使用和关注。然而,许多人在使用GitHub时,常常会问:使用GitHub违法吗?本文将从多个方面探讨这个问题,包括版权、合规性、使用规则等,帮助你更全面地了解使用GitHub的法律框架。

1. GitHub概述

GitHub成立于2008年,是一个基于Git的版本控制和协作开发平台。它允许开发者共享代码、管理项目,并进行版本控制。在这个平台上,开发者可以创建公共或私有的代码库,进行代码的上传、下载和管理。

2. GitHub的法律框架

2.1 用户协议与服务条款

使用GitHub之前,用户需要同意其用户协议和服务条款。这些协议中明确规定了用户在使用平台时的权利和义务,包括对知识产权的尊重和对内容的合法使用。

2.2 知识产权问题

使用GitHub时,知识产权是一个重要的法律问题。用户上传的代码可能涉及到他人的版权,因此在分享和使用代码时,应注意以下几点:

  • 确保拥有代码的版权:上传自己创作的代码,确保没有侵犯他人的知识产权。
  • 遵循开源许可证:如果代码是开源的,确保遵守相应的开源许可证条款。
  • 尊重其他用户的作品:在使用其他人的代码时,确保给予适当的引用和署名。

2.3 版权和开源协议

GitHub支持多种开源许可证,例如MIT、Apache、GPL等。每种许可证都有其特定的要求和条款,用户在使用和分享代码时,必须遵循这些条款,避免因不当使用而引发的法律问题。

3. GitHub的合规性问题

3.1 数据隐私与保护

在使用GitHub时,用户需要遵守相关的数据隐私和保护法律。例如,欧洲的GDPR(通用数据保护条例)规定了数据收集、存储和处理的规范。在处理个人数据时,用户需确保合规。

3.2 反洗钱与合规要求

在某些情况下,GitHub上的某些项目可能与金融交易或加密货币相关,用户需确保遵守相关的反洗钱法律和合规要求。

4. 常见的误解与疑问

4.1 使用GitHub会导致法律责任吗?

如果用户在GitHub上上传了侵权或不合法的内容,是有可能承担法律责任的。因此,用户应时刻保持警惕,确保自己的行为合法。

4.2 我可以使用他人的代码吗?

可以,但必须遵循开源许可证的要求。如果没有明确的许可证,建议先联系原作者以获得使用许可。

4.3 如果我的代码被盗用,我该怎么办?

如果发现自己的代码被盗用,可以通过GitHub的DMCA(数字千年版权法)流程进行举报,保护自己的合法权益。

5. FAQ

5.1 使用GitHub违法吗?

使用GitHub本身并不违法,但若上传的内容侵犯他人的版权或违反平台的使用条款,则可能会导致法律问题。确保遵循所有法律法规和GitHub的规定是必要的。

5.2 我能在GitHub上存储敏感信息吗?

不建议在GitHub上存储任何敏感信息,特别是私有数据或机密信息,因为这些信息可能被不当访问。最好使用专门的安全存储服务。

5.3 GitHub会监控我的代码吗?

GitHub有权根据其服务条款对用户行为进行监控,确保平台的安全和合规。然而,用户的个人信息和项目内容一般不会被公开,除非存在法律要求。

5.4 如何处理侵权问题?

若发现侵权情况,首先应收集证据,然后可以通过DMCA流程向GitHub提交投诉,要求删除侵权内容。

结论

总之,使用GitHub并不违法,但用户必须遵守相关的法律法规和GitHub的使用条款。通过遵循最佳实践,确保版权合规,用户可以安全、合法地使用GitHub这一强大的工具,促进代码共享与合作。希望本文能够为广大开发者提供有益的法律指导。

正文完